What Are Mitochondria? Mitochondria are double-membraned organelles found in many eukaryotic cells. Their primary function is to convert nutrients into adenosine triphosphate (ATP), the energy currency of the cell. Beyond energy production, mitochondria also play roles in signaling, cellular distinction, cell death, and maintaining cellular health. As individuals age, mitochondrial function tends to decline, leading to decreased energy levels and increased vulnerability to different illness. This decrease can stem from a mix of genetic elements, environmental stressors, and lifestyle choices, highlighting the significance of supporting mitochondrial health through lifestyle and diet plan. Coenzyme Q10 (CoQ10) CoQ10 is a fat-soluble antioxidant that plays a pivotal role in mitochondrial function by helping with ATP production. This supplement has been connected with improved energy levels, particularly in people with persistent tiredness or those taking statins, which can diminish natural CoQ10 levels. 2. L-Carnitine L-Carnitine supports energy production by carrying fatty acids into mitochondria for oxidation. This supplement may benefit endurance athletes or anyone looking for to enhance their total physical efficiency. 4. Acetyl-L-Carnitine Acetyl-L-carnitine, a more bioavailable kind of L-carnitine, has been revealed to have neuroprotective homes alongside its advantages for energy metabolism. It's typically recommended for cognitive support and might help fight age-related cognitive decrease. 5. Pterostilbene Pterostilbene, a compound discovered in blueberries, has actually acquired attention for its possible mitochondrial benefits. Its mechanism consists of the activation of sirtuins, proteins that play an essential role in cellular health and longevity. 6. Magnesium This vital mineral is important for energy production and the appropriate functioning of mitochondria. Magnesium deficiency can result in decreased ATP production, supporting the argument for supplementation to improve mitochondrial function. 7. Resveratrol Known for its association with the advantages of red white wine, resveratrol might improve mitochondrial biogenesis and function. Its activation of SIRT1 has ramifications for cellular health, durability, and improved metabolic function. 8. NAD+ Precursors (e.g., NMN, NR) Nicotinamide adenine dinucleotide (NAD+) is essential to energy production in mitochondria. Supplementing with its precursors, like Nicotinamide riboside (NR) or Nicotinamide mononucleotide (NMN), has revealed promise in increasing NAD+ levels, thereby enhancing mitochondrial efficiency and vitality.
